Rončević Dolac
Rončević Dolac is a hamlet in Senj, Kvarner. Rončević Dolac is situated nearby to the hamlet Sveti Križ, as well as near Krmpotići.Places of Interest
Highlights include Vratnik and Senj Hydroelectric Power Plant.

Senj Hydroelectric Power Plant
Power station
Senj Hydroelectric Power Plant is a large high-pressure diversion power plant harnessing the Lika and Gacka Rivers water in Croatia. Senj HPP has four turbines with a nominal capacity of 72 MW each having a total capacity of 220 MW. Senj Hydroelectric Power Plant is situated 3 km southwest of Rončević Dolac.
